INTRODUCTION
The Danish Refugee Council (DRC), an international non-governmental organization (NGO), has been providing relief and development services in the Horn of Africa since 1997. DRC promotes and supports solutions to the problems faced by refugees, internally displaced people (IDPs), and migrants. The organization has offices across the region and has been operational in Ethiopia since 2009. With funding from bilateral and multilateral donors, DRC is currently implementing a range of activities across Ethiopia and Djibouti, including WASH and shelter provision, child and youth protection, gender-based violence response, awareness-raising of migration risks, protection monitoring of migration routes, and livelihoods support for returning migrants or those at-risk of migration.
OVERALL PURPOSE OF THE ROLE:
Safety Officer will oversee safety matters directly or indirectly related to all DRC personnel, assets, and programs within the Area. This includes assuring Safety Risk Management System (SRMS) and responsibility for planning, implementing, monitoring, and reporting measures required to ensure safe delivery of aid. S/he will also supervise Guards and coordinate day-to-day movement and transportation, as per standards operation procedures, rules, and regulations.
